The Oncofertility Consortium Japan (OC Jpn) meeting 2019 and the annual meeting of JSFP were hosted jointly with 480 participants on Gifu City, Japan from 9 to 10 February 2019. 

At the OC Jpn meeting in the 1st day, Dr. Tatsuro Furui(Dept Ob/Gyn, Gifu University) presented the outline of OC Jpn.  After that, the current state of regional medical collaboration was reported by Dr. Shin-ichi Tachibana,(Dept Ob/Gyn, Tohoku University) and Dr. Sachiyo Yoshimura(Dept of Breast Surgery, the Aichi Cancer Center).

In addition, Dr. Chie Watanabe (Dept Nuring, Sophia University), Dr. Masato Yonemura (Dept Pharmacy,the National Cancer Center East Hospital), and Dr. Yuka Ito (psycologist of Gifu University Hospital Perinatal and Reproductive Medical Center), raised various problems on the current situation and issues about oncofertility and discussed with the participants.  Lastly, Dr. Nao Suzuki (Chairman of JSFP), talked about the reviews and future prospects and brought the meeting to a close.

In the part of JSFP annual meeting, various concerns and expectations were discussed in the sessions of HPV vaccination, male cancer patients, AND perinatology. 

In addition, the present and future situation of the financial support, remote counselling, and patient registration were also presented.
